  Docket of CACR32  Docket Abbreviations
Bill Title: relating to clarification of certain language. Providing that all references to people in the constitution shall refer to both male and female.

Official Docket of
CACR32.:
Date Body Description
1/13/2010SIntroduced and Referred to Judiciary; SJ 2, Pg.31
1/27/2010SHearing: February 2, 2010, Room 103, State House, 3:15 p.m.; SC5
2/2/2010SHearing: === RECESSED === February 2, 2010, Room 103, State House, 3:15 p.m. SC6
2/3/2010SHearing: === RECONVENE === February 9, 2010, Room 103, State House, 3:15 p.m.; SC6
3/17/2010SCommittee Report: Ought to Pass 3/24/10; SC12
3/24/2010SWithout Objection, Chair moved to Special Order forward; SJ 11, Pg.227
3/24/2010SOught to Pass, RC 24Y-0N, MA; OT3rdg; SJ 11, Pg.240
3/24/2010SPassed by Third Reading Resolution; SJ 11, Pg.256
3/24/2010HIntroduced and Referred to Judiciary; HJ 30, PG.1521
3/31/2010HPublic Hearing: 4/6/2010 10:00 AM LOB 208
4/13/2010HExecutive Session: 4/20/2010 10:00 AM LOB 208 ==RECESSED==
4/20/2010HContinued Executive Session: 4/29/2010 10:00 AM LOB 208
5/3/2010HCommittee Report: Refer to Interim Study for May 12 (Vote 14-3; RC); HJ 37, PG.1743
5/12/2010HRefer to Interim Study: MA DIV 281-17; HJ 41, PG.2088
5/12/2010HReferred to the Judiciary Committee for Interim Study
8/31/2010HInterim Study - Subcommittee Work Session: 9/28/2010 2:00 PM LOB 208
9/29/2010HInterim Study - Executive Session: 10/27/2010 10:00 AM LOB 208
10/29/2010HInterim Study Report: Recommended for Future Legislation in 2011 (Vote 8-3); HC 62, PG.2468
